Some Liverpool fans have taken to Twitter to point the finger at Jordan Henderson for his involvement in Harry Kane’s opener at Anfield on Sunday.
The 55-cap England international misplaced a pass in the opening minute of the game against Tottenham, and then saw his side come under attack from Mauricio Pochettino’s side after his error.
He failed to win the ball back before helplessly watching Kane nod the north Londoners in front, and his incompetence did not go unnoticed by some Liverpool fans on Twitter.
Henderson’s error left the European champions chasing the game throughout the first half, but he then scored a second-half equaliser against the side who Liverpool beat in the Champions League final to kickstart a comeback – Mohamed Salah’s penalty earned the Reds a 2-1 win.
One supporter said that the former Sunderland man should never have started in the first place, whereas another said that the 29-year-old is having a “shocker” of a campaign so far.
